The Andean condor is the national bird of Ecuador.

This is a list of the bird species recorded in Ecuador including those of the Galápagos Islands. The avifauna of Ecuador has 1663 confirmed species, of which eight are endemic to the mainland and 31 are endemic to the Galápagos. Four have been introduced by humans, 78 are rare or vagrants, and one has been extirpated. An additional 41 species are hypothetical (see below).

Except as an entry is cited otherwise, the list of species is that of the South American Classification Committee (SACC) of the American Ornithological Society.[1] The list's taxonomic treatment (designation and sequence of orders, families, and species) and nomenclature (common and scientific names) are also those of the SACC.[2]

The following tags have been used to highlight certain categories of occurrence.

  • (V) Vagrant - a species that rarely or accidentally occurs in Ecuador
  • (EG) Endemic - Galápagos - a species endemic to the Galápagos Islands
  • (EM) Endemic - mainland - a species endemic to mainland Ecuador
  • (I) Introduced - a species introduced to Ecuador as a consequence, direct or indirect, of human actions
  • (H) Hypothetical - a species recorded but with "no tangible evidence" according to the SACC
